LYNNE TOLLEY / MISS MARY BOBO'S
1/4 c golden raisins
1/4 c whiskey
3 large sweet onions (like Vidalia), coarsely chopped (about 6 cups)
2 T oil
1 T brown sugar
1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es, drained
Pinch of thyme
Salt and pepper, to taste
Combine raisins and whiskey in small bowl; set aside to soak. Cook onion in oil in a large skillet over medium-low heat until tender and golden brown, about 15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Stir in brown sugar and continue to cook 5 minutes. Stir in tomatoes, raisins and whiskey.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er 10 minutes or until thickened. Season with thyme, salt and pepper. Cool, cover and refrigerate. Serve chilled or at room temperature.
Makes about 2 1/2 cups.
